Martin Dies Jr. State Park's Hen House Ridge Unit sits deep in East Texas Pineywoods where the Angelina and Neches rivers meet the Steinhagen Reservoir. Forested with pines, oaks, cypress, and magnolia trees, the park offers over 200 campsites across multiple loops, most with water and electric hookups. Amenities include screened shelters, cabin rentals, and a nature center with ranger programs. Paddle nearly 14 miles through sloughs and rivers, or hike and bike the extensive trail system. Fish for catfish and bass, swim in the lake and rivers, or spot deer, raccoons, bobcats, alligators, and herons in their natural habitat.
